OpenAI and Anthropic share findings from a joint safety evaluation

OpenAI Blog

OpenAI and Anthropic released results from a joint safety evaluation where they tested each other's AI models across multiple failure modes including misalignment, instruction-following errors, hallucinations, and jailbreak vulnerabilities. The evaluation assessed both companies' most capable models available at the time of testing, with results published to document specific strengths and weaknesses in each system. The findings demonstrate that direct collaboration between competing labs can identify safety issues more comprehensively than single-lab evaluations.
